Very few drinks are as aesthetically pleasing as a glowing, crisp glass of liquid gold. This appearance grants a very real sense of luxury and richness to white wines, as they can almost seem like something that only exists in myth, a golden drink that is served only to gods and emperors. Their refreshing nature is appreciated all around the globe, making them an ideal choice for a hot summer afternoon, perhaps an outdoor meal with your family in the countryside. The zesty acidity of a lot of white wines and their ability to leave your mouth dry and begging for more makes it very hard to stop at one glass.

There are many blends to choose from when it comes to fine, crisp white wine, each offering a unique moment of satisfaction as you explore the layers of flavor and texture. A bottle of oaked Chardonnay (the world’s most popular white wine) can steal your heart with a rich, succulent vanilla flavor and compete for your attention with any gourmet dish you can imagine. Meanwhile, a glass of the Italian classic Pinot Grigio introduces a beautiful composition of lemon, green apple, and lime, bringing a strong Mediterranean charm wherever you may live.

White wines offer something for everyone, and the journey to find your perfect white wine is as exciting and emotional as the journey to find a soulmate. 1998 Veuve Clicquot La Grande Dame Rose

There’s a firm, juicy pinot noir at the core of this rosé, a bold young wine that’s packed with citrus acidity and intensely concentrated fruit. If you open it now, the wine will need food to bridge its power, whether roast quail with chanterelles or a steak with sautéed wild mushrooms. Or cellar it, relying on the exceptional balance and depth of flavor to sustain the wine as it ages.Wine & Spirits Magazine | 95 W&SExotic notes of toasted coconut and rum spice accent this fresh and elegant rosé, while flavors of macerated cherry and plum, pastry and pomegranate ride the delicate texture. Graceful, with a mouthwatering finish. Drink now through 2020.Wine Spectator | 93 WSCopper-pink with a frothy mousse. Smoky strawberry and cherry aromas are complicated by buttered toast, blood orange and dried flowers. Deep and chewy, with vivid red berry and bitter cherry flavors underscored by dusty minerals. Gains power on the broad, focused and gently nutty finish. Already complex, and ready to drink.Vinous Media | 92 VM

2014 aubert chardonnay cix California White

Lastly, the virtually perfect 2014 Chardonnay Cix Estate, planted with a Montrachet clone on Goldridge soils, again exhibits amazing intensity, notes of wet gravel interwoven with apple blossom, caramelized citrus, apricot, white peach and honeysuckle. It is full-bodied, multidimensional and a profound glass of Chardonnay.Robert Parker | 99 RPDense and racy in style, the 2014 Chardonnay CIX Vineyard is one of the more approachable wines in this lineup. Here the Montrachet clone gives a Chardonnay with good up-front intensity and plenty of power. Although attractive, the CIX doesn’t quite have the complexity, nuance or persistence of the best wines in the range.Vinous Media | 94 VM

2022 Henri Boillot Corton Charlemagne Grand Cru

Powerful, dense, and supple, the Corton Charlemagne from Boillot is an impressive wine with aromas of ripe apple, quince and apricot, floral notes, and butter. The grapes are sourced from parcels in Aloxe and Pernand; Boillot purchases the fruit as grapes, and his team does the harvest and the pressing. The result is classic Corton-Charlemagne in style that will open properly in three to five years and should age for 20 beyond that.Decanter | 96 DECThe 2022 Corton-Charlemagne Grand Cru is a blend of fruit from Aloxe-Corton (75%) and Pernand-Vergelesses (25%), a combination that works well in giving the wine balance. There’s quite a bit of phenolic intensity and youthful austerity here. Herbs, crushed rocks, graphite, mint and citrus confit build nicely. I very much admire the vibrancy here, even if the 2022 remains a bit unyielding today. - Antonio GalloniVinous Media | 93-95 VM
